Output 34af3cce77ba441822f3dab185dddcf5fe3ddf1b499906c9a1b27f6dfdc8499e:5

value
158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 172d82a76defe217afd2b5ce5db67bbe1cc3a140 OP_EQUAL
address
33oZz5793mY4NUGxkP4JYecFk2gED3aU2R
transaction
34af3cce77ba441822f3dab185dddcf5fe3ddf1b499906c9a1b27f6dfdc8499e
confirmations
152110
spent
true